Pay Rates for "Medical Instrument Technician"

How much does a Medical Instrument Technician in the federal government get paid? $65,088.60* *Based on the 2021 average.

Medical Instrument Technician was the 73rd most popular job in the U.S. Government in 2021, with 3,705 employed. The most common payscale was the general schedule payscale.

In 2021, the Veterans Health Administration hired the most employees titled Medical Instrument Technician, with an average salary of $65,038.

Government Medical Instrument Technician jobs are classified under the General Schedule (GS) payscale. The minimum paygrade for a Medical Instrument Technician job is GS-1, and the highest paygrade that can be attained within this job series is GS-9. Remember that the starting and maximum yearly pay listed above reflect base pay only - your actual salary will be higher based on the Locality Pay Adjustment for the area in which you work.

Job Description

This occupation includes positions that perform diagnostic examinations or medical treatment procedures as part of the diagnostic or treatment plan for patients. The work involves operating or monitoring diagnostic and therapeutic medical instruments and equipment associated with cardiac catheterization, pulmonary examinations and evaluations, heart bypass surgery, electrocardiography, electroencephalography, hemodialysis, and ultrasonography. Positions in this occupation require a knowledge of the capabilities and operating characteristics of one or more kinds of instruments and a practical knowledge of human anatomy and physiology. Positions also require a practical understanding of medical data generated by patient/equipment connections. Some positions also require a practical knowledge of chemistry, pharmacology, physics, and mathematics.
